This print showcases Claude Monet's masterpiece, "Waterlilies with effects of clouds" painted between 1914 and 1917. The oil on canvas artwork measures an impressive 130x150 cm and is housed in the prestigious Musee Marmottan Monet in Paris, France. Monet, a renowned French artist (1840-1926), was a pioneer of the Impressionist movement. This particular painting beautifully captures his signature style and fascination with nature. The serene water lilies floating on the surface of a pond are brought to life by the vibrant colors and delicate brushstrokes. The title aptly describes how Monet skillfully incorporated the ethereal effects of clouds into this composition. The interplay between light and shadow creates a dreamlike atmosphere that transports viewers to a tranquil oasis. It is as if one can almost feel the gentle breeze rustling through the leaves and hear the soft ripples in the water. Monet's ability to capture fleeting moments in nature is evident here, as he masterfully depicts both stillness and movement within this scene.
